Along with elbows, carbon steel pipe fittings likewise consist of tees, which attach 3 areas of pipe, developing joints for liquid flow. Equal tees are utilized when the linking branches are of the exact same diameter, while reducing tees are employed when the branch pipe is of a smaller size. Along with common fittings, pipe bends add another layer of versatility to piping systems. Standard bends, such as 90-degree bends, are indispensable to guiding flow without sharp corners that can hamper performance. For applications requiring steady changes, 5D bends and 3D bends are perfect, offering smoother reversals to reduce pressure loss. These butt weld bends are crafted to match the required specifications for pressure scores, thus ensuring compatibility and safety and security within the system.

Beyond tees and elbows, the realm of flanges values discuss. Flanges, consisting of types such as SO flanges (Slip-On), WN flanges (Weld Neck), and BL flanges (Blind), function as crucial elements in piping systems. Carbon steel flanges are particularly prominent due to their toughness and cost-effectiveness. The option of flange kind ought to straighten perfectly with the desired application and fluid homes, making certain a leak-proof and safe joint.
